摘要
Thinly spread: Ultrathin layers of exfoliated MoS2 exhibit remarkable photoluminescence which is absence in bulk MoS2. The intensity of the fluorescence is further enhanced by Ag@SiO2 core/shell composites due to on metal-enhanced fluorescence (see picture). Copyright © 2012 WILEY-VCH Verlag GmbH & Co.
